Output 53262d26a44ce2f4783661983a05e92e139414a7f90c7919fbd538b8b92c2962:4

value
79576535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11d3cf7f1679a2f75a939e24d3b8c220ecf6fca6 OP_EQUAL
address
M9XRTYa6kyZsBnGA9eztccVwzEEDqFsnFZ
transaction
53262d26a44ce2f4783661983a05e92e139414a7f90c7919fbd538b8b92c2962
spent
true